CVE-2018-19600 describes a Cross-Site Scripting (XSS) vulnerability in Rhymix CMS version 1.9.8.1, specifically exploitable through SVG file uploads via the admin file box. This medium-severity vulnerability, rated 4.8 CVSSv3, requires high privileges and user interaction, allowing an attacker to inject malicious scripts with limited impact on confidentiality and integrity. There is no evidence of active exploitation, public exploit code (Metasploit, Nuclei, ExploitDB), or significant community discussion or media coverage surrounding this CVE.
